Guwahati, Feb. 6 -- Tension gripped Batadrava Than in central Assam's Nagaon district on Friday as supporters of the ruling BJP and opposition Congress were engaged in a bitter war of words over the visit of Congress leaders including APCC chief Gaurav Gogoi, AICC observer Jitendra Singh and others.

The incident took place when Congress leaders including APCC president Gaurav Gogoi, Jitendra Singh, Lok Sabha MP Pradyut Bardoloi and others arrived at the historical Batadrava Than to seek blessings at the sacred pilgrimage site. The Congress leaders arrived at the Than as part of its Paribartan Yatra (Journey of Change) which the party plans to take to every nook and corner of Assam.
